With Croatian (HRV) keyboard active, instead of executing commands
beginning-of-buffer and end-of-buffer, M-< and M-> just insert
'<' and '>' characters in most (but not all) buffers.
C-h k M-< gives: '< runs the command self-insert-command' in all user
buffers open with C-x C-f.
Also, in '*GNU Emacs and '*About GNU Emacs*' buffers M-< gives '< is undefined'.
In the following buffers it works correctly:
*Help*, *Messages*, *Buffer List*, *Bug Help*

With e.g. Spanish keyboard which has exactly the same <> key
postion (next to Left Shift) everything works OK. Also with US keyboard.
No problems with CRO(HRV) keyboard in Emacs 24.5 either.
